Hygro-Thermometer Calibration Procedure

1. Range of application

This technical document specifies the procedure for the calibration of hygro-thermometers with humidity measuring ranges from 20 to 90% RH with 0.1% RH accuracy, temperatures from -20 to 150 ° C, accuracy of 0.1 ° C.

2. Calibrating techniques
- Outside check
- Technical check
- Measurement check
- Measurement Uncertainty Evaluation

3. Calibrating instruments

3.1 Standard measuring instrument (s)

Standard Heating & Cooling Chambers:


- Range of measurement: (-20 ÷ 150) °C

                                         (20 ÷ 95) %RH

- Accuracy: 0,1 °C

                   0,1 %RH

3.2 Other measuring instrument(s)
Hygro-Thermometer:


- Range of measurement: (0 ÷ 50) °C
- Accuracy: ±0.5 °C
- Range of measurement: (10 ÷95) %RH
- Accuracy: ±3%RH

3.3 Auxiliary Instrument(s)
- Water Distillation Unit
- Decimal Stopwatch/Clock
- Alcohol, dedicated gloves, towel

4. Conditions for Calibration
Temperature: (25 ± 2) °C
Humidity: ≤80 %RH

5. Prepare for Calibration
Prior to the calibration, the following preparations must be done:
- Clean the hygrometer to be calibrated.
- Select a standard suitable for the technical requirements of the equipment to be calibrated.
- Turn on the drying of the hygrometer to be calibrated according to the manufacturer's operating instructions.

8. General handling

a. The calibrated Hygro-thermometer is stamped, certified in paper along with calibration results, correction number, and measurement uncertainty at each check point.

b. The recommended calibration cycle of Hygro-thermometer is 12 months.
